India plans more durable ad curbs on booze creators such as Carlsberg, Diageo, Pernod, ET Retail

.Rep imageIndia, which disallows straight advertising of alcohol, is actually readied to reveal cleaning policies that will ban even surrogate advertisements as well as sponsoring of occasions, which might oblige firms like Carlsberg, Pernod Ricard and also Diageo to revise advertising and marketing campaigns.Such "surrogate adds" typically get pivot the ban through seemingly showing a lot less pleasing items rather, like water, music CDs or glass wares garbed in logo designs and also hues connected to their crucial product, as well as frequently advertised through preferred Bollywood movie celebrities. Today they can deliver penalties for providers as well as restrictions for personalities recommending tobacco and also booze adds regarded misleading, depending on to the leading public server for customer gatherings and also draught guidelines being reported for the first time by Reuters. "You can not take a rambling technique to promote products," the official, Nidhi Khare, told News agency, including that ultimate guidelines were counted on to be provided within a month. "If we locate advertisements to be surrogate and deceptive, after that even those who are actually backing (products), consisting of celebrities, are going to be actually held responsible." As an example, brewer Carlsberg markets its own Tuborg alcohol consumption water in India, with an ad showing movie celebrities at a roof dancing party and also the trademark "Tilt Your Planet", which mirrors its beer advertisements in other places, decorated with the message: "Drink Sensibly". Competition Diageo's YouTube add for its Black &amp White ginger ale, which has drawn 60 million perspectives, features the signature black-and-white terriers from its scotch of the very same name. The modifications endanger a seachange for booze makers in India, the globe's eighth-biggest alcohol market through quantity, along with annual revenues Euromonitor estimates at $forty five billion. Increasing abundance amongst its 1.4 billion people makes India a profitable market for the likes of Kingfisher beer maker, United Breweries, component of the Heineken Team, which possesses greater than a quarter of market allotment by quantity. Popular for their whiskies, Diageo and also Pernod, taken with each other, have a market reveal of regarding a fifth, while for Pernod, India provides about a tenth of worldwide profits. The brand-new rules ask for "restriction versus taking part in surrogate advertisement", which includes supports and also ads for items deemed "company extensions" that share the characteristics of an alcoholic drinks label, the draft stated. Charges under the brand-new policies rely on customer law, opening up makers and also endorsers to fines of around 5 million rupees ($ 60,000), while promoters risk promotion bans ranging from one to 3 years. Carlsberg decreased to comment, while various other providers performed not respond to Wire service' concerns, including those on sales of non-alcohol products. Members of the International Moods and Glass Of Wines Affiliation of India, which exemplifies Diageo as well as Pernod, "are actually committed to a compliant method of building brand expansion companies," mentioned its own outward bound president, Nita Kapoor. The group resided in speaks along with the authorities and supported advertising and marketing of "legitimate" brand extensions, she added. Wellness IMPACTThe World Health Company states bans or comprehensive curbs on alcohol advertising "are actually affordable actions" for hygienics. Its own information presents India's usage of liquor each are going to rise to almost 7 litres in 2030, from concerning 5 litres in 2019, a duration over which fellow Oriental large China's consumption will lose to 5.5 litres.And alcohol-related fatalities in India stood at 38.5 for every single 100,000 of its own populace, versus 16.1 for China.Khare mentioned India's draft complied with an evaluation of international greatest methods, in countries such as Norway, which disallows advertisements for booze as well as other items depending on functions of a spirits company, in aesthetics that scientists point out have reduced booze sales with time. The brand-new draft policies prohibit advertising of products including soda or popular music CDs using a "similar label, design, design, company logo" to that of booze products, clearly targeting attempts to navigate existing bans.Ads for things such as glasses as well as soft drink canisters permit "trademark name to appear with all their ads, making its own repeal worth for the buyers," having said that, the draft states.The brand-new guidelines comply with warnings to some spirits companies, including Pernod, and some domestic cigarette firms to halt misleading ads, an elderly federal government resource stated, talking on disorder of anonymity.India is actually certainly not versus brand expansion ads, the representative incorporated, however prefers all of them to adequately portray the product being actually showcased, as opposed to giving buyers the opinion that the add is actually for a liquor brand.One India video clip advertised by Pernod, seemingly for glasses items connected to its own whisky company, Blenders Take pride in, presents Bollywood star Alia Bhatt walking a ramp under blinking nightclub illuminations, and also stating, "My lifestyle, my take pride in." While it has a logo design similar to that of the whisky label, the online video, which likewise shows up on the internet site of the Blenders Satisfaction Glass Wares Fashion trend Trip, shows no glass wares products.
